Freightliner 2015 Suspension recall

Recalled June 25, 2014 · NHTSA recall 14V367000 · Freightliner

Hazard
The axle weak spots could cause the axle beam to bend or cause wheel separation, increasing the risk of a crash.
Remedy
DTNA will notify owners, and dealers will inspect the axle beams for certain manufacturing dates, and replace the ones manufactured within a certain date range, free of charge. The recall began on August 22, 2014. Owners may contact DTNA customer service at 1-800-385-4357. DTNA's number for this recall is FL-662.
Units
192 units

Description

Daimler Trucks North America LLC (DTNA) is recalling certain model year 2015 Freightliner Cascadia, 122SD, and Business Class M2 trucks manufactured March 20, 2014, through April 10, 2014. Due to an axle manufacturing error, there may be weak spots in the beam of the affected axle assemblies.
